Transaction ed7d3da785c4909f6408c7b6571faf81f9560abe4271dbf81a7a0804495c7286

1 Input
2 Outputs
  • ed7d3da785c4909f6408c7b6571faf81f9560abe4271dbf81a7a0804495c7286:0
  • value  27743777
    address  3FEkurLNBY1VNphdXgLYsnzhABWVAK1RQp
  • ed7d3da785c4909f6408c7b6571faf81f9560abe4271dbf81a7a0804495c7286:1
  • value  16800000
    address  3FYwbZo9UUJepbh4aaWyN6H9e4PApFnTnU